eBay to open London ‘pop-up’ store for Christmas shopping
eBay is to open a ‘pop-up shop’ in London during the busiest shopping period in the run up to Christmas.
More: continued here
eBay is to open a ‘pop-up shop’ in London during the busiest shopping period in the run up to Christmas.
More: continued here